Review: Woolly the Jumper iPhone/ iPod Touch
There is a lot to like about Woolly the Jumper. The game is very stylish and has fun background music. You play as a sheep running from a crazed farmer who robs you of both wool and life.

Woolly uses a trajectory based system to jump from one platform to another across the screen. As you complete these jumps, you can collect cherries to add to your points. There are 4 levels and each increases in difficulty. The jumping is fun but it soon gets frustrating. The trajectory is not perfect. Although the angles all looked correct, I still sometimes missed ledges and ended up back at the first jump. If this were the only issue, the games would still be very addictive. You’ll notice I said “if.” Sadly, it isn’t the case. Woolly is being chased to a farmer who is looking steal your wool. As he takes the wool, he also takes one of your lives. I found it nearly impossible to escape the farmer because once the farmer entered the screen, I was unable to jump or dodge him. This is the biggest problem with the game. Woolly also has a couple of bugs. Sometimes, after completing a series of jumps, my sheep would disappear from the screen entirely. Then the farmer would show up and I’d be out a life.
Fortunately, Woolly the Jumper also comes in a Lite version. I recommend trying it before you buy it.
Woolly the Jumper is Available from the Apps Store for $.99. Woolly the Jumper Lite is also available from the Apps Store and it is free.
